Youth Movement

The Life Time Foundation's Youth Movement pillar champions physical activity programs because kids who move regularly learn better, sleep better, and develop stronger bodies and minds. Physical activity plays a critical role in childhood, helping children develop lifelong habits that support their social, emotional, physical, and cognitive well-being. Schools offer a unique opportunity with built-in schedules and community support for active lifestyles.

Youth Nutrition

The Life Time Foundation's Youth Nutrition pillar works to eliminate ingredients of concern from school meals. Nutritious, minimally processed food helps children thrive physically, mentally, and emotionally. Public school food programs offer one of the most effective ways to improve children's nutrition nationwide by providing healthier, more delicious meals. Healthy Planet

The Life Time Foundation's Healthy Planet pillar supports forestation, conservation, food forests, and local green spaces because environmental health and access is directly linked to kids' wellbeing. Children who grow up connected to nature become environmental stewards. Every child deserves access to healthy outdoor spaces where they can learn, play, and thrive.
